Contributions summary:Seth contributed to the Arkime project by implementing new features and fixing existing issues related to network packet capture and analysis. This involved adding functionality to export network diagrams as PNGs using JavaScript and SVG manipulation. The user also added a flag to control locking of offline PCAP files and improved the hunt packet search functionality. Furthermore, the user introduced a new setting for Elastic Common Schema (ECS) event datasets and improved query expression support with the `db:` prefix.
